async def _render_manim_locally(
    scene_name: str,
    file_path: str,
    output_dir: str,
    quality: str,
    format_type: str,
    frame_rate: int,
) -> Dict[str, Any]:
    """Render a Manim animation using local Manim installation."""
    try:
        # Ensure output directory exists
        Path(output_dir).mkdir(parents=True, exist_ok=True)

        # Map quality to manim flags
        quality_flags = {
            "low": "-ql",
            "medium": "-qm",
            "high": "-qh",
            "production_quality": "-qp",
        }
        quality_flag = quality_flags.get(quality, "-qm")

        # Find the project root and .venv
        # Assume the project root contains .venv directory
        project_root = Path(__file__).resolve().parent.parent
        venv_python = project_root / ".venv" / "bin" / "python"
        venv_manim = project_root / ".venv" / "bin" / "manim"

        # Use venv manim if it exists, otherwise fall back to system manim
        if venv_manim.exists():
            manim_cmd = str(venv_manim)
            logger.info(f"Using .venv manim at: {manim_cmd}")
        else:
            manim_cmd = "manim"
            logger.warning(f".venv manim not found at {venv_manim}, using system manim")

        # Build the manim command
        cmd = [
            manim_cmd,
            quality_flag,
            "--fps",
            str(frame_rate),
            "-o",
            f"{scene_name}.{format_type}",
            file_path,
            scene_name,
        ]

        logger.info(f"Running local Manim command: {' '.join(cmd)}")

        # Execute the command with .venv in PATH
        env = os.environ.copy()
        if venv_manim.exists():
            venv_bin = project_root / ".venv" / "bin"
            env["PATH"] = f"{venv_bin}:{env.get('PATH', '')}"
            env["VIRTUAL_ENV"] = str(project_root / ".venv")

        # Execute the command
        process = await asyncio.create_subprocess_exec(
            *cmd,
            stdout=asyncio.subprocess.PIPE,
            stderr=asyncio.subprocess.PIPE,
            cwd=output_dir,  # Run in output directory
            env=env,
        )

        stdout, stderr = await process.communicate()

        if process.returncode != 0:
            error_msg = f"Local Manim rendering failed:\nSTDOUT: {stdout.decode()}\nSTDERR: {stderr.decode()}"
            logger.error(error_msg)
            return {"text": error_msg, "isError": True}

        # Log the stdout for debugging
        logger.info(f"Manim stdout: {stdout.decode()}")
        logger.info(f"Manim stderr: {stderr.decode()}")

        # Find the output file
        # Manim typically outputs to media/videos/{filename}/{quality}/
        import glob

        # First, let's see what files actually exist in the output directory
        logger.info(f"Listing all files in output directory: {output_dir}")
        try:
            all_files = list(Path(output_dir).rglob("*"))
            logger.info(f"Found {len(all_files)} files/dirs:")
            for f in all_files[:50]:  # Log first 50 to avoid spam
                logger.info(f"  - {f}")
        except Exception as list_error:
            logger.warning(f"Could not list files: {list_error}")

        # Manim outputs to paths like: media/videos/{filename}/{resolution}/SceneName.mp4
        # where resolution is like: 720p30, 480p15, 1080p60, 2160p60
        # Quality flags map to resolutions:
        # -ql (low): 480p15
        # -qm (medium): 720p30
        # -qh (high): 1080p60
        # -qp (production): 2160p60

        # Map quality to likely resolution folder names
        quality_to_resolution = {
            "low": ["480p15", "854x480", "480p"],
            "medium": ["720p30", "1280x720", "720p"],
            "high": ["1080p60", "1920x1080", "1080p"],
            "production_quality": ["2160p60", "3840x2160", "2160p"],
        }

        resolutions = quality_to_resolution.get(quality, ["720p30"])

        output_patterns = []

        # Search with specific resolutions
        for res in resolutions:
            output_patterns.extend(
                [
                    f"{output_dir}/media/videos/*/{res}/{scene_name}.{format_type}",
                    f"{output_dir}/media/videos/**/{res}/{scene_name}.{format_type}",
                ]
            )

        # Fallback: search all resolution patterns
        output_patterns.extend(
            [
                f"{output_dir}/media/videos/*/*/{scene_name}.{format_type}",
                f"{output_dir}/media/videos/**/{scene_name}.{format_type}",
                f"{output_dir}/videos/*/*/{scene_name}.{format_type}",
                f"{output_dir}/**/{scene_name}.{format_type}",
                f"{output_dir}/{scene_name}.{format_type}",
            ]
        )

        output_files = []
        for pattern in output_patterns:
            logger.info(f"Trying pattern: {pattern}")
            matches = glob.glob(pattern, recursive=True)
            if matches:
                logger.info(f"  Found matches: {matches}")
                output_files.extend(matches)
                break

        if not output_files:
            error_msg = f"Could not find rendered output file.\nSearched patterns: {output_patterns}\nStdout: {stdout.decode()}\nStderr: {stderr.decode()}"
            logger.error(error_msg)
            return {"text": error_msg, "isError": True}

        output_file = output_files[0]  # Take the first match
        final_output = Path(output_dir) / f"{scene_name}.{format_type}"

        # Move the output file to the expected location
        import shutil

        shutil.move(output_file, final_output)

        result_msg = (
            f"Successfully rendered animation locally!\n"
            f"Scene: {scene_name}\n"
            f"Output file: {final_output}\n"
            f"Quality: {quality}\n"
            f"Format: {format_type}\n"
            f"File size: {final_output.stat().st_size if final_output.exists() else 'Unknown'} bytes"
        )

        logger.info(result_msg)
        return {"text": result_msg, "isError": False}

    except Exception as e:
        import traceback

        error_details = traceback.format_exc()
        error_msg = (
            f"Error during local Manim rendering: {str(e)}\nDetails: {error_details}"
        )
        logger.error(error_msg)
        return {"text": error_msg, "isError": True}

async def merge_video_audio(arguments: Dict[str, Any]) -> CallToolResult:
    """Merge video and audio files."""
    video_file = arguments["video_file"]
    audio_file = arguments["audio_file"]
    output_file = arguments["output_file"]

    try:
        # Ensure output directory exists
        Path(output_file).parent.mkdir(parents=True, exist_ok=True)

        # Build FFmpeg merge command
        cmd = [
            "ffmpeg",
            "-i",
            video_file,
            "-i",
            audio_file,
            "-c:v",
            "copy",
            "-c:a",
            "aac",
            "-shortest",
            "-y",  # Overwrite output file
            output_file,
        ]

        logger.info(f"Merging video and audio: {' '.join(cmd)}")

        process = await asyncio.create_subprocess_exec(
            *cmd, stdout=asyncio.subprocess.PIPE, stderr=asyncio.subprocess.PIPE
        )

        stdout, stderr = await process.communicate()

        if process.returncode != 0:
            error_msg = f"Video/audio merge failed: {stderr.decode()}"
            logger.error(error_msg)
            return CallToolResult(
                content=[TextContent(type="text", text=error_msg)], isError=True
            )

        result_msg = f"Successfully merged video and audio: {output_file}"
        logger.info(result_msg)

        return CallToolResult(content=[TextContent(type="text", text=result_msg)])

    except Exception as e:
        error_msg = f"Error during video/audio merge: {str(e)}"
        logger.error(error_msg)
        return CallToolResult(
            content=[TextContent(type="text", text=error_msg)], isError=True
        )
